WEB程序设计
1440!
这个作者很懒,什么都没留下…
展开
-
asp:GridView 使用增加删除行
<asp:GridView ID="gv_Office" runat="server" AutoGenerateColumns="false" GridLines="None" OnRowDataBound="gv_Office_RowDataBound" HeaderStyle-CssClass="headercss" Width="100%"> <Colu翻译 2016-11-04 09:53:02 · 944 阅读 · 0 评论 -
控制台输出,输入
控制台输出C# 控制台程序一般使用 .NET Framework Console 类提供的输入/输出服务。Console.WriteLine(“Hello World!”); 语句使用 WriteLine 方法。它在命令行窗口中显示其字符串参数并换行。其他 Console 方法用于不同的输入和输出操作。Console 类是 System 命名空间的成员。如果程序开头没有包含using System;转载 2017-01-12 16:34:30 · 965 阅读 · 0 评论 -
WebConfig配置文件详解
<?xml version="1.0"?><!--注意: 除了手动编辑此文件以外,您还可以使用 Web 管理工具来配置应用程序的设置。可以使用 Visual Studio 中的“网站”->“Asp.Net 配置”选项。设置和注释的完整列表在 machine.config.comments 中,该文件通常位于 "Windows"Microsoft.Net"Framework"v2.x"Config 中转载 2017-01-26 14:34:00 · 976 阅读 · 0 评论 -
display和visibility的区别
大多数人很容易将CSS属性display和visibility混淆,它们看似没有什么不同,其实它们的差别却是很大的。visibility属性用来确定元素是显示还是隐藏的,这用visibility=”visible|hidden”来表示(visible表示显示,hidden表示隐藏)。当visibility被设置为”hidden”的时候,元素虽然被隐藏了,但它仍然占据它原来所在的位置。例: <s原创 2017-05-04 15:59:47 · 464 阅读 · 0 评论 -
vs 2008 断点空心加感叹号 解决方案
在vs2008中,有时会出现设置的调试时,断点红色断点出现黄色的感叹号,并提示与原版本不同,现两种解决办法。1、“工具”,“选项”,“调试”,“要求源文件与原始版本完成匹配”去掉勾。 2、通过重新格式化出问题的源文件亦可以解决,即在VS2008中选择 “编辑”-“高级”-“设置选定内容的格式”。 http://blog.csdn.net/guoguojune/article/details/9转载 2017-05-18 17:53:08 · 7027 阅读 · 0 评论 -
动态修改HtmlGenericControl的属性
为HtmlGenericControl写一个扩展方法,可以修改它的显示内容,text public static class HtmlGenericControlExtend { public static HtmlGenericControl SetBtnText(this HtmlGenericControl hgcParam, string btnText)原创 2017-05-21 10:27:18 · 1534 阅读 · 0 评论 -
Literal控件的用法
1、Literal的一般用法,与Label对比MSDN上的解释:使用System.Web.UI.WebControls.Literal 控件在网页上保留显示文本的位置。Literal 控件与Label 控件类似,但 Literal 控件不允许对所显示的文本应用样式,可以通过设置 Text属性,以编程方式控制在控件中显示的文本。Literal Web 服务器控件介绍可以使用Literal Web 服务转载 2017-05-21 10:50:26 · 6654 阅读 · 0 评论 -
aspx页面引用dll和前段写客户端代码
今天写项目的时候,需要在前台页面写重载一个方法,方法写好的时候,出现了如下的问题: 没有引用此类在网上找了一番评论:找到了如下的解决方案:在<%@ Import namespace=”System.Security.Principal” %>问题成功解决:原创 2017-06-26 09:08:04 · 2193 阅读 · 0 评论 -
ADO.NET图形介绍
ADO.NET图形介绍原创 2017-07-28 14:52:55 · 216 阅读 · 0 评论 -
前端工程师必备的几个实用网站
一、配色类网站http://colorhunt.co这个网站给我们提供了很多的配色方案,我们直接使用就OK了。使用方法也很简单,鼠标移动到对应的颜色上,我们就可以看到颜色的十六进制码,复制这个颜色到工具里就可以使用了。https://webgradients.com/180种渐变方案供你选择,还可以直接复制CSS样式应用到网页中https://color.adobe.com/zh/cre...转载 2018-12-13 15:33:48 · 159 阅读 · 0 评论 -
标点符号使用说明
~ 按位求补符; ^ 异或位运算符; & 且位运算符; | 或位运算符; \ 用于转义符的开始,如\n表示换行; ” 包裹字符串;’ 包裹单个字符; , 用于分隔参数; . 用于表示对象成员选择器或小数点 ; 用于条件编译或划分代码块。 如:#if #else #define #region #endregion ? 单个常用于表示可空的值类型,如:i原创 2017-01-11 18:25:53 · 779 阅读 · 0 评论 -
execl数据导入;以构建表为准
构建临时DataTable #region 构建临时DataTable private DataTable CreateDataTable() { DataTable dt = new DataTable(); dt.Columns.Add("ISBN"); dt.Columns.Add("书名原创 2016-12-29 16:46:19 · 346 阅读 · 0 评论 -
js验证数据格式和文本框是否为空
function check_btnStart() { var pass = true; $("#t_CommodityMove").find("[tag]").each(function () { if (this.value.trim() == '') { alert($(this).parent().prev().text().trim(原创 2016-11-04 10:03:04 · 570 阅读 · 0 评论 -
CSS块级元素和行内元素
**块元素**一般都从新行开始,它可以容纳内联元素和其他块元素。 如果没有css的作用,块元素会顺序以每次另起一行的方式一直往下排。而有了css以后,我们可以改变这种html的默认布局模式,把块元素摆放到你想要的位置上去。 **块元素(block element)和内联元素(inline element)**都是html规范中的概念。块元素和内联元素的基本差异是块元素一般都从新行开始。而当加转载 2016-10-28 11:21:10 · 512 阅读 · 0 评论 -
object 检验字符类型之间的转化
public class VerifyConvert{ #region 检测任意一个类型的数据是否可以转换成整型类型 /// <summary> /// 检测任意一个类型的数据是否可以转换成int类型 /// </summary> /// <param name="obj">需检测的变量</param> /// <returns></returns>翻译 2016-11-14 09:47:18 · 410 阅读 · 0 评论 -
WebService的使用方法
1.在自己的项目中引用自己的WebService 1.1创建WebService:右击项目-》添加新项-》web服务(asmx) 1.2 在WebService.asmx.cs页面中添加方法1.3查看运行WebServices 1.4在本项目中需要代用的地方直接NEW此服务 2.在其他项目中引用WebServic原创 2016-12-13 09:48:47 · 339 阅读 · 0 评论 -
使用Repeater中的OnItemCommand,OnItemDataBound
通过点击左边导航栏,调用事件使用Repeater中的OnItemCommand,OnItemDataBound客户端代码: <asp:Repeater runat="server" ID="RepeaterKeyWord" OnItemCommand="RepeaterKeyWord_ItemCommand" OnItemDataBound="RepeaterKeyWord_ItemData原创 2016-12-27 11:44:32 · 2657 阅读 · 0 评论 -
一般处理文件ASHX中使用取不到SESSION
在IHttpHandler的父类中使用了Session,在后台代码中调用该Session,但是抛出异常说该Session是Null,在网上查询相关资料说必须继承借口:IReadOnlySessionState 或 IRequiresSessionState,必须应用System.Web.SessionState命名空间 public class getemployee : IHttpHandler,转载 2016-12-28 11:04:21 · 1107 阅读 · 0 评论 -
EXCEL导出
string fileName = “XXX统计表”; HSSFWorkbook wb = new HSSFWorkbook();//创建一个工作薄 ISheet sheet = wb.CreateSheet();//在工作薄中创建一个工作表 int columnCount = 0;原创 2016-11-02 08:32:51 · 601 阅读 · 0 评论 -
C#邮件提醒
1.申明邮件类public class EMail { private MailMessage mMailMessage; //主要处理发送邮件的内容(如:收发人地址、标题、主体、图片等等) private SmtpClient mSmtpClient; //主要处理用smtp方式发送此邮件的配置信息(如:邮件服务器、发送端口号、验证方式等等)原创 2016-12-20 11:09:19 · 2436 阅读 · 0 评论 -
C#初始化数组的三种方式
C#初始化数组的三种方式 public static void PrintArray() { string[] arrayA = { "Shirdrn", "Hamtty", "Saxery" }; Console.WriteLine("第一种声明数组并初始化的方法"); for (int i = 0; i转载 2017-01-16 09:27:20 · 30345 阅读 · 0 评论 -
上传文件到本地操作和上传到Azure云上
上传到Azure中需要引用using Microsoft.WindowsAzure.Storage;using Microsoft.WindowsAzure.Storage.Blob;using System;using System.Drawing;using System.IO;using System.Web;namespace WEBAPI.Common{ pu...原创 2019-08-08 15:49:20 · 2555 阅读 · 0 评论